iPad Demand Surges as Apple Strengthens Grip on Tablet Market

Apple expanded its lead in the global tablet market in late 2025 as overall shipments rebounded, according to new research from Omdia.


Global tablet shipments reportedly reached 162 million units in 2025, representing 9.8% year-over-year growth. The research firm said the strongest momentum occurred during the holiday quarter, when shipments reached 44 million units, also up 9.8% compared to the same quarter a year earlier. Omdia described the annual total as the highest shipment volume recorded since the surge in demand seen in 2020, partly caused by anticipation of memory supply constraints.

Apple was a key contributor to the market's late-year growth. Omdia says that Apple shipped 19.6 million iPads in the fourth quarter of 2025, representing a 16.5% year-over-year increase. The firm said this performance was driven by strong demand for the 11th-generation iPad and the M5 iPad Pro.

The fourth-quarter results increased Apple's market share to 44.9%. This placed Apple well ahead of other tablet vendors during the holiday quarter, with Samsung at 14.7%, Lenovo at 8.8%, Huawei at 6.9%, and Xiaomi at 6.4%. Other manufacturers collectively accounted for the remaining 18.3% of shipments.

The report also highlighted changes in how tablets are expected to be positioned in the coming years, including greater emphasis on ecosystem integration and artificial intelligence features:

On the product side, we expect a shift in how tablets are positioned and marketed, with vendors framing them as ecosystem-centric devices in a more controlled demand environment. This includes the introduction of cross-OS functionality and a focus on AI-driven experiences. Recent examples include Lenovo's Qira, which operates across Windows and Android to deliver a more seamless user experience and reduce friction between AI assistants. In addition, the collaboration between Apple and Google to use Gemini for future Apple Intelligence features represents a positive step forward for the generative AI ecosystem across its device portfolio, including iPads.


Regional performance varied across the year. Omdia said Central and Eastern Europe recorded the fastest growth in 2025, followed by Asia Pacific. All regions experienced double-digit growth except North America, where vendor and retail discounting helped offset an otherwise declining trend during the holiday season.

iPhone 17 Pro Max vs. Android Battery Life: New Test Reveals Winner

A broad new smartphone test has found that Apple devices lead the industry for battery life, with the iPhone 17 Pro Max ranking as the longest-lasting phone tested and Apple tied as the top overall brand.


CNET this week published the results of a large-scale battery-life comparison based on testing conducted throughout 2025 across 35 smartphones sold in the United States. According to the report, Apple and OnePlus ranked as the two brands with the strongest battery performance overall, based on averaged results from multiple battery benchmarks.

The top-performing individual device in the testing was Apple's ‌iPhone 17 Pro‌ Max, which finished first overall despite not having the largest battery capacity among the tested phones. It has a battery capacity of 5,088 mAh, and its extended battery life is largely attributed to silicon efficiency and software optimization.

The iPhone 17 tied for second place alongside the OnePlus 15. The ‌iPhone 17‌ achieved this ranking despite having the smallest battery capacity among the top-performing phones. The Poco F7 Ultra placed third, while the ‌iPhone 17 Pro‌ placed fourth in the overall rankings.

CNET's methodology included standardized tests using two benchmarks designed to minimize real-world variability. The first involved streaming video over Wi-Fi at full brightness for three hours, while the second was a 45-minute endurance test that included gaming, video streaming, social media scrolling, and a video call. Results from both tests were averaged to determine final rankings.

The ‌iPhone 17 Pro‌ Max again ranked first in the endurance benchmark, followed by the ‌iPhone 17‌, ‌iPhone 17 Pro‌, and iPhone 16e. The publication noted that Google's Pixel 10 and Pixel 10 Pro Fold also performed well in this specific test, along with Motorola's Razr.

The experiment also compared battery life across smartphone brands by averaging results from companies for which at least three models were tested. Apple and OnePlus ranked first and second respectively in overall brand battery performance. Motorola and Samsung followed in third and fourth place, while Google ranked fifth.

Apple Hoping to Outdo Rivals With Tougher Display for Foldable iPhone

Apple is reportedly evaluating a tougher display film technology for its first foldable iPhone as it tests materials that could differentiate the durability and feel of the screen from rival devices.


According to a new supply chain report from The Elec, Apple is evaluating transparent polyimide film as a protective layer that would sit on top of the ultra-thin glass used in the foldable display. The report says the company is currently testing two options for this outer film: polyethylene terephthalate (PET) and clear polyimide (CPI).

Most of today's foldable displays use ultra-thin glass to improve clarity and rigidity, but the glass still requires a flexible polymer film on top to prevent scratches and damage. This is the layer that users actually touch, making it a key factor in overall durability and feel.

Samsung currently uses PET film as the protective layer on top of the ultra-thin glass in its Galaxy Z Fold and Galaxy Z Flip devices. The Elec says Apple's evaluation of CPI is rooted in a wish to differentiate its approach. CPI is more expensive than PET, but has better surface hardness and scratch resistance.

Kolon Industry has apparently emerged as a potential supplier of the material. The company previously built a mass production line for CPI film after anticipating strong demand from upcoming foldable devices. China-based Lens Technology is expected to supply the ultra-thin glass for the foldable ‌iPhone‌ and will handle bonding the final protective film to the glass.

The final decision on the protective film is expected to be made soon as Apple continues testing remaining components of the first foldable ‌‌iPhone‌‌. Other rumors suggest that the device will feature a 7.8-inch crease-free inner display, a 5.5-inch cover display, ‌Touch ID‌, two rear cameras, the A20 chip, and the "C2" modem. It is expected to launch alongside the iPhone 18 Pro and ‌‌iPhone 18‌‌ Pro Max later this year.
